Maersk Oil Takes Stake Offshore Norway

Maersk Oil Takes Stake Offshore Norway

Friday, April 15, 2011
Maersk Oil

Maersk Oil has been awarded a 30% non-operated share in License PL597 on the Halten Terrace offshore Norway in the 21st Licensing Round.

The operator of the license is VNG Norge A/S (40%) with Dana Petroleum Plc as partner (30%). Together with Maersk Oil, the partners are committed to carrying out seismic data reprocessing leading to a decision whether to drill an exploration well.

"This license award fits well with Maersk Oil's strategy of building up a strong exploration portfolio in our chosen focus areas in Norway. It adds to our current interests in four other licenses on the Halten Terrace," said Morten Jeppesen, Managing Director of Maersk Oil Norway.

"We are committed to growing our business in Norway through exploration and acquisitions to build a significant portfolio of exploration and producing assets in the coming years," Jeppesen said.
